Lighting platform set for commercial market

Tyco Electronics and Redwood Systems have announced a strategic collaboration to pioneer Redwood's lighting platform in the commercial lighting market.

The platform - a lighting system that fuses intelligent control, communications and power delivery into an integrated, networked system - is claimed to make smart lighting simple and cost-effective, and provide users with expanded ways to visualise and optimise their buildings.

The system, which operates on both LED technology and traditional halogen and fluorescent technology, estimates energy savings up to 75 per cent for standard building lighting.

Tyco Electronics will collaborate with Redwood on a comprehensive solutions package, which includes a combination of the company's core competencies, for integration into this high-level system.

The package will provide the foundational infrastructure necessary to enable, as well as complement, the lighting system, such as commercial premises structured cabling systems, circuit protection devices and interconnect systems.

The platform is composed of three discrete elements that work in concert to create a programmable 'building fabric'.

The three components include the Redwood engine, a central driver that provides and modulates power; the Redwood adapter, a group of sensors at each light fixture; and the Redwood wall switch.

The system, connected with Tyco Electronics low-voltage cabling, facilitates 'plug-and-play' behaviour to reduce installation time.
